lt is 11 years since there was a wedding in our Church of England until 24th ult. ; and, strange to say, the bridegroom in the last case was a brother to the one who did the trick recenty).

The marriage referred to was that of Miss Levina Grace Aspery, second daughter of Mr. John Aspery, of Sackville, to Mr. Frederick Booker, a son of Mr. John Booker, Surry Hills, Sydney. Rev. W. Nawton, M.A., officiated. The bridesmaids were Misses Booker and Robinson, from Sydney, and the groomsmen were Messrs. R. Booker and "Jack" Aspery. The bride was given away by her father. The church was tastefully decorated by the friends of the bride. About fifty relatives and friends were present at the breakfast. Rev. Mr. Newton proposed the toast of the bride and bridegroom in felicitous, terms. He was particularly complimentary to the bride, who had always taken an interest in the church work. She was a 'member of the choir, and sometimes helped at the organ. He considered that Mr, Booker was a wise young man to book her. (Ahem !) The presents were numerous.

BOOKER—ASPERY.—February 24. 1904, at St. Thomas' Church. Sackville Reach, Lavinia Grace Aspery to Frederick Thomas Booker. Present address, Errolholme, Killoola Street, Concord West.
